How do I Use AI for YouTube Automation?

Step 1: Let AI Help You Find Your Niche (Or Validate Yours)

You might already know what your channel is about. But do you know exactly what your audience wants to watch?

Instead of guessing, use AI to research faster.

The Process:
Take your general topic—let’s say “affiliate marketing”—and ask a tool like ChatGPT or Gemini a simple question:
“List the top 10 questions beginners ask about affiliate marketing.”

Take that list and plug it into YouTube’s search bar. See what videos pop up. Look at the comments on those videos. What are people confused about? What are they asking for that the video didn’t cover?

Then, go back to your AI tool and ask it to create video titles based on those gaps. You aren’t letting AI run your channel; you are using it to speed up your market research.

Step 2: Scriptwriting That Sounds Like You

This is where most people go wrong. They ask AI to write a script, copy-paste it, and read it verbatim. The result? Robotic, lifeless content that viewers click away from in the first 30 seconds.

Here is the better way.

The Process:

  • Draft your bullet points. Write down the 3-5 main points you want to cover. This is your knowledge.
  • Use AI to flesh it out. Ask the AI to turn your bullet points into a conversational script. Give it context. Tell it: “Write this like a friendly expert explaining it to a friend. Use short sentences. Avoid jargon.”
  • Rewrite the intro and outro yourself. The first 30 seconds and the last 30 seconds need your personality. This is where you connect with the viewer.

The AI gives you the skeleton. You provide the heartbeat.

Step 3: The Voice—Keep It Real

Text-to-speech robots are easy to spot, and viewers hate them. If you want to build a sustainable online income, you need trust. It is hard to trust a robot voice.

The Options:

  • Record yourself. Even if you are camera-shy, your real voice builds authority. You don’t need fancy equipment; your phone is fine.
  • Use AI Voice Cloning (Ethically). If you absolutely cannot record, tools like ElevenLabs allow you to create an AI version of your own voice. You record a sample once, and then you can generate voiceovers that sound exactly like you. This is the only “robot” voice I recommend because it is actually your voice.

Do not use the generic robotic voice that comes free with editing software. It kills your channel’s growth potential.

Step 4: Visuals and B-Roll in Seconds

Finding stock footage used to take hours. You would search “person working on laptop,” watch ten clips, download two, and repeat.

AI has changed the game.

The Process:
Tools like Pictory, InVideo, or even Canva’s AI video tools can now take your script and automatically find matching stock footage. You paste your text, and the software scans millions of clips to match your keywords.

You still need to review the footage and make sure it makes sense, but it cuts your editing time from four hours to forty-five minutes.

Step 5: Editing Hacks That Save Hours

If editing is the part you dread, let AI handle the boring stuff.

  • Silence Removal: Tools like Descript or Adobe Podcast can automatically remove all the “ums,” “uhs,” and awkward silences from your raw audio. One click, and your speech is crisp.
  • Auto-Captions: Viewers watch with sound off. Adding captions is non-negotiable. AI tools can generate 95% accurate captions instantly. Just scan them quickly to fix any weird typos.
  • Thumbnail Generation: You still need a great thumbnail. But you can use AI image generators (like Midjourney or Canva’s AI) to create unique backgrounds or elements that you cannot find in stock photos. Combine these with your own face for a thumbnail that stands out.

Step 6: Optimizing for Search (SEO the Easy Way)

You want Google to find your video. You also want YouTube to recommend it. This is where a little AI help goes a long way.

The Process:
After you finish your script, paste it back into ChatGPT. Ask it:
“Based on this transcript, what are 5 frequently asked questions?”
Use these questions in your video description or as a comment pin.

Then ask:
“Suggest 10 tags and a title for this video based on SEO best practices.”

Don’t just use the first title it gives you. Mix and match. Use the AI’s ideas with your own gut feeling about what your audience will click.

FAQs

Will YouTube penalize me for using AI content?

No. YouTube penalizes low-quality content. If your script is thin, your visuals are boring, and your voice is robotic, you won’t rank. If you use AI to enhance your real knowledge, you are fine.

How much does this cost?

You can start for free. Canva has free AI tools. ChatGPT has a free version. Descript has a free tier. As you scale and need higher quality, you might spend $50–$100/month on tools. That is much cheaper than hiring an editor.

Can AI grow my channel by itself?

No. AI can produce videos, but it cannot build a community. It cannot reply to comments with empathy. It cannot network with other creators. That is still your job.
